Include Surprising CostsEven with a well-defined project scope, homeowners must be ready to face unexpected expenses that can come up during bathroom remodeling projects. Such costs often arise from various origins, including hidden plumbing defects, outdated electrical systems, or the necessity for additional permits. Structural repair needs are frequently ignored, especially in older houses where damage is not apparent until renovation begins. Furthermore, design changes or the choice of luxury materials can cause higher costs. To prevent financial surprises, it is beneficial to allocate an emergency fund amounting to 10-20% of the overall budget. Ultimately, a strong portfolio guarantees homeowners feel confident in their choice of remodeling partner.Sustaining Your Recently Remodeled BathroomAlthough a freshly renovated bathroom can bring joy and functionality to a home, it also requires careful maintenance to preserve its beauty and efficiency. Regular cleaning is crucial; using non-abrasive cleaners helps preserve surfaces without causing damage. Everyday maintenance, such as cleaning counters and fixtures, prevents the buildup of grime and mildew.Inspecting pipes and fittings for leaks is imperative, as even minor drips can lead to substantial water deterioration over time. Additionally, keeping an eye access now on grout and sealant guarantees that moisture does not penetrate walls, which could result in mold growth.Ventilation functions as a vital component in preserving a fresh atmosphere; using exhaust fans during and after showers helps reduce humidity.
